BBL Stars Join ILT20 for Ultimate Cricket Showdown

In the realm of T20 cricket, the Big Bash League (BBL) has always been a hotspot for electrifying contests, but this season faces a daunting challenge as several marquee players depart for the International League T20 (ILT20) in the United Arab Emirates. Let’s delve into the key players who’ve bid adieu to BBL in pursuit of ILT20 glory.

1. Sam Billings: A Shift in Allegiance

The dynamic England wicketkeeper-batter, Sam Billings, an instrumental figure for the Brisbane Heat, is now bound for the Dubai Capitals. Despite a commendable performance in the BBL, scoring 285 runs in 11 innings, financial allure has steered him towards ILT20.

2. Colin Munro: Heat’s Captain Set to Sizzle in ILT20

Colin Munro, the explosive skipper of Brisbane Heat, leaves a void as he heads to represent the Desert Vipers in ILT20. Munro’s impactful role in Heat’s league dominance, scoring 209 runs at a blistering strike rate, makes his absence felt in the BBL knockouts.

3. Jamie Overton: A Star on the Rise

English all-rounder Jamie Overton, a standout for the Adelaide Strikers in BBL, with 16 wickets in the league stages, now gears up for the ILT20 with the defending champions, the Gulf Giants. His multifaceted skills promise to be a valuable asset in the upcoming season.

4. Chris Lynn: Veteran Batsman’s ILT20 Commitment

Chris Lynn, the seasoned T20 campaigner, bows out of the BBL playoffs to honor his commitment to the Gulf Giants in ILT20. His stellar BBL season, amassing 304 runs at a staggering average, showcases the experience that the Giants will benefit from in their title defense.

5. James Vince: Gulf Giants’ Pillar of Consistency

A vital cog in Gulf Giants’ 2023 title triumph, James Vince, with a solid BBL season, departs, leaving a void in Sydney Sixers’ lineup. His absence is keenly felt, evident in the Sixers’ struggles during the powerplay in the playoff clash against Brisbane Heat.

6. Laurie Evans: Scorchers Lose a Veteran Presence

Perth Scorchers’ veteran Laurie Evans, after an impactful 72-run knock in the final league-stage encounter, joins the Abu Dhabi Knight Riders in ILT20. His absence poses a challenge for the Scorchers, requiring a three-match win streak for a potential three-peat.

Addressing the Exodus: BBL’s Future Strategies

The significant player exodus prompts the question: What measures can the BBL adopt to prevent such instances in the future? As the league grapples with overlapping schedules and player commitments, strategic planning and schedule adjustments could be key. Engaging with players to synchronize league calendars and minimize clashes might be a step in the right direction.
